Default High Pitched Whistling

I just got a new 08 Silverado LTZ and have noticed that there is a high pitched whistling coming from the engine that is very annoying. Has anyone else had this issue?

Default RE: High Pitched Whistling

Do you have a bug shield on? I found that with my '07, I felt the need to raise the hood slightly to prevent contact with grill when closed, so I raised the hood slightly (just a bit). That was enought to cause bad high pitched howl when at 55MPH or more. I ended up bringing the hood back down just a bit, that was enough to get rid of the noise.

Check your air induction cover at base of windshield to make sure it's not loose, otherwise take it back to dealer and complain
